Hogyan kell használni a cookie-k php
Mentsd cookie-t a böngészőjében, akkor egy egyszerű funkció php setcookie (). Teljes függvény szintaxisa a következő:
bool setcookie (string $ name [, string $ value [, int $ lejár = 0 [, string $ path [, string $ tartomány [, int $ biztonságos = false [, int $ HttpOnly = false]]]]]])
Ebben az esetben a szükséges paramétereket, sőt, csak két: $ nev és $ value, azaz egy pár „kulcs-érték.” Nézzünk egy példát.
Tegyük fel, hogy meg akarjuk menteni a számértéke 5 cookie nevű SajatSzam. Ezt megtehetjük a következő:
Ha azt akarjuk, ez a süti már csak 2 óra, akkor kell hozzá egy harmadik paraméter - „élettartam” cookie:
Ha törölni szeretnénk egy adott cookie, akkor mindegy setcookie () függvényt. beállítás hosszabb az eltelt időt, és egy üres érték:
Nézzük meg egyéb paraméterek által hozott funkció:
- $ path - ha ez szükséges korlátozni a könyvtárat a szerveren, ahonnan a cookie tárolja hozzáférhető
- $ tartomány - ha a megadott második szintű domain, a süti elérhető lesz hozzá, és aldomainjeibe
- $ biztonságos - ha megadjuk igaz, a cookie-t küld, ha van egy biztonságos kapcsolat https
- $ HttpOnly - ha igaz a cookie csak viszi át a http-protokoll